How many people have seen the same (one) image ?
How suggestive is an image that can go around the world in a few seconds and has been broadcast by every press organ?
One striking example is the enormous cover of 9/11 around the world .It is not overdone to say that everyone has seen at least one image related to that event, that a collective imagination has been created ,giving thousands of people the same landmarks and memories .This gives us a glimpse of the power of the media and of the unconscious import of the image our eyes absorb.
What room is left for doubt, for a critical spirit ? Are we able and willing to escape their hold ?

Five years ago I settled in the abandonned Renault factory.This place I took (occupied) with other people, artists ,militants,in order to transform the initial environment( a shed for industrial storage) into creation workshops and a living laboratory for artistic, poetic and political research (NTA) ,a 34,000 meters square dissident space within a society won by triumphant liberalism,a crossroads for creators, their medium and the exploration of the many sides of art .The idea was to make it a free and autogere space for possibles.

I always payed great attention in my own personal process to all kinds of graphic signs :drawings, graffitti, PICTO,paintings,tags;IDEOGRAMMES
...At the crossroads of image and writing ,they are amongst the most active and imaginative forms of communication,always in search of renewed meaning and sense .Everyday, people explore these visual forms ,connecting them to their own life story ,energies and knowledge.
As for myself, confronted to an excess of images , in a society of the Image , weary of absorbing graphic signals inducing me to change my way of life for that of the advertisements, I felt like stopping on various images that have touched me more than others. (fights,opposition,conflict,war,rivalry,discord,antagonism,duel,battle...).
My research about the meaning and sense induced by the signs has found its matter in the flow of images poured out daily by the mass media : newspaper,tv ,web...

information-suggestion-propaganda

The object of my process is to use ,understand and change the image ; to re-use it , make it mine ,take it out of its context,change its basic aim and turn it into an object of subversion,a prejudice taking the shape of pictural dissidence (counter propaganda), an attempt to create and nourish the counter-movement libertarian propaganda) to question the continuous flow of images (liberal propaganda) that establish common landmarks for a thousand million people around the world .
For the mass media confess all they ever wanted was to « sell available brain-time to the advertisers »,to make the people more servile to the the products overproduced by this society of mass production.Advertisers would'nt want people to start questionning the soundness of their lifestyle,would they ?

In quite the same way as the word , the image conveys sense and meaning . There is a root to a word ,that helps us decifer its origin and first meaning.An image has no such definitive SEMIOLOGIE ,for it is the result of life's perpetual movement .A physical ,inward and outward movement gives its strength to the image, to the sketch you catch ,to the picture suggesting life in movement (photography,poster,filmed image,digital image,painting..) .There is also the semantic side of it , the totemic chronology of the image ,of its history,of its own meaning.
I have great interest and curiosity for oriental IDEOGR.,the way image and writing merge in calligraphy,pushing the image towards the idea,creating shapes to adapt the local language and IDEOGR complex and pure .

Image and representation of the image

I often wonder about the image in the public space ,whether it belongs to me or not,since it is meant for me as much as for others.I am not given a choice to see or not see that kind of informative advertising-image, I have to see it, I undergo its presence , it is enforced on me ,I cannot not see it , it gets into my subconscious ,and nestles in it.The mass media have understood that hammering a particular sequence of images can change history ,the image makes you buy,the image makes you dream,it sells utopia within reach.

The material for that series of « hijacked images for use in counter-propaganda » I fished for in the mass media: snapshots, web images , daily newspapers, mostly topical events from march 2004 to march 2005.I made a hundred screen savings, picked up dozens of images on the web and explored the free and national newspapers.Out of this prolific mass of information I chose the images that most appealed to me for their conflictual carachter. Fighting is a constant theme in the media.
Dispute and fighting are considered barbarian in the west and wherever the liberal society has settled.There is no room for violence in a society of rights in which conflicts are solvedfrom court to court and wars are considered (nothing but) the « dark hours of history » .Despite this roundabout of good manners and double sided politeness I believe I am at the heart of the most violent society man can live in. This is the core of my work.Violence is part of our daily life,however hard you try to deny,make up or mask them ,conflict and violence are within us at every second ,and even though I'm not directly part of it I contribute to it as a voyeur.

I started by an immersion in the media,out of curiosity and voyeurism, I stuffed myself with topical issues and images ,then I drew the great lines ,started some snapshots on tv shows,on everything related to the whole (thing).Tv covers up an infinite field in the representation of all that is physical and real and gives access to timeless interpretations by fantasy and the uncredibly unreal.

Methodology
Image capture transformation
Transparency-projection
Petroleum and fill-in
Message,writing,slogan
Installation

After selecting a panel of images I started transforming them with a retouch software
to deprive the image of its context and the message of its primary discursive value, pervert the meaning, and make the image only a model for a new reflection ,still based on the modified originals.The possibilities offered by the softwares in image treatment are quite impressive,so I chose to hold on to a basic script so as not to dissipate and end up merely with computer presentation help work
My models I printed on transparent sheets to be projected on various surfaces (canvasses stretched or slack, bare walls...).

With a marker I transpose my image on a certain format, the result is quite random ,because my canvass-formats are different,unlike my transparencies that are all A4. A deformation takes places,between the initial pattern and the original centering.

This whole series wants to be an evocation of the surplus of this society ,of the overproducing of manufactured consumer goods and cultural consumer goods .Thus I chose not to buy anything , I helped myself around, salvaged and called for donation .
I sought inspiration in the italian artists of arte povera who work with little and tell a lot.That's how I came across huge cans of fuel(liquid tar ).Oil has been known since antiquity for its unique watertightness.It is said the sarkophages of the mummies of ancient Egypt as well as Noah's Arch in the mythological story of the Bible were coated with a black liquid treacle for protection.It is pure petroleum and strangely enough it is that very product that allows today's overproduction of consumer goods.And it is also the cause of the conflict that will establish the rise or fall of the liberal society.
Once my subjects were drawn on the canvass ,I questionned myself on FIGURATION and the relevance these themes .
« Leaving the watcher to himselflooking at a semi figurative /semi realistic image » does not produce the reaction I wish to offer. I am in a process of making propaganda ,and I want to re-use and imitate the advertising leaflet .
I choose to hammer my subject,I will not let the watcher's imagination wander ,so I introduced the text in graphical ballons ,as in comics or mangas.My painting becomes a graphic plate,mixing introspective drawing, writings and pictographic objects.I meddle in the work initiated by Wahrol and the pop art , and in the research work of the advertisers , who try to catch the eye of the audience introducing in its head an idea-concept,so as to induce a change in behaviour through the subconscious image .I believe the advertisers produce great work when it comes to capturing attention and getting into someone's head with a concept.
The work of south corea artist Wang Duhe treats « those everyone has seen ».
The poetical dimension in Djamel Tatah's work reminds me the extraordinary subjectivity painting can convey.
I was touched by Jenny Holzer's work her sober figurative work and the relevance of her conceptual research.It gave me inspiration to use minimalistic slogans ,thus I named one of my canvasses try not to cry.
The image evokes the reading of the charges against a western war prisoner ( or hostage ?) held by an islamist faction in Irak , just before having his throat cut by one of the menbers of the group.On the web you can see the terror of the orange-clothed prisoner ( in memory of guantanamo) and his tragical end . Besides the uneasiness provoked by the image, what I want here and with this image; is to make visible the hatred generated by the behaviour of the whole ruling class of the G8 countries in the 3d world, and show my solidarity with the people of the south.

After drawing and writing my big formats , I went through a more random step ,involving a painting I wanted to be quite instinctive . ,unlike the first steps called »scripts ».The scripts have their method ( graphics, petroleum and industrial meatl painting),while the painting part involves using everything I came across :oil or acrylic paint, pastels ... A layer of acrylic varnish gives the whole installation a glossy unity .

The aim of that sequence painting is to evoque an A4 page (portrait or landscape-wise )as there exists one everywhere something is for sale .I based myself on these leaflets that invade our letter boxes to give us cosumerist choices .By imitating the advertising process, I take on the role of
those who relentlessly try to change the audience's behaviour,I bring them to a confrontation with the image from the mass media and a familiar graphic treatment,at the same time introducing absurd ,not to say subversive messages.

The installation I want to realise would be 6m high by 5m ,in order to make commonplace and grandiloquent the hijacked images .Create a facade unity ,an impression of trop plein (the endlessly repeated image ) and use sentences that induce the contrary of what is shown.
